Use the ac adapter to plug your HP Jornada into external
power whenever possible, especially when connecting to a
desktop PC, when using a PC Card modem, network interface
card (NIC), or other peripheral. Do not let the alarm
notification LED flash for a long time.
This section offers information that will help you customize your
HP Jornada to match your working style.
As on your desktop PC, use Control Panel to change most of your
HP Jornada options.
·
Double-tap any of the icons in Control Panel to explore the
options for that feature. Specific Control Panel options are
described below. For more information about a particular control
panel, see the Settings topic in online Help.
• Communications—Use the Communications control panel to
set options for establishing a connection between your HP
Jornada and desktop PC.
• Dialing—Use the Dialing control panel to manually create
dialing locations and set dialing options for connecting to a
service provider or remote computer.
• Display—The Display control panel allows you to
set the background image and the appearance of your MS
Windows for H/PC 2000 desktop.
• HP hot keys—Use the HP hot keys control panel to customize
your HP Jornada hot keys and hard icons. For more
information, see the Customizing the HP hot keys and
hard icons section in this chapter.
• HP security—Set primary and reminder password protection
to control access to your HP Jornada, and use the security log
to record access attempts.
To open Control Panel
On the Start menu, point to Settings, and then tap Control
Panel.
